Research on Guided Roadway Pressure Relief Combined Supporting Technology in High Stress Roadway
The problem of maintaining the surrounding rock in deep high-stress roadway has been a major subject in coal mining. The analysis of high stress roadway supporting mechanism, and the research on high stress roadway supporting technology as well as its adaptability have important significance in improving the support technology of mine. This paper analyzes the features and reasons of the high stress roadway deformation and failure, and the high stress roadway supporting measure is put forward. At the same time the paper systematically analyzed the guided roadway pressure relief combined support technology which has been used in the transporting roadway in Taoyang Coal Mine and achieved good.
